Recognizing Oral Emergency Situations
If your child experiences severe tooth pain or a knocked-out tooth, these are indicators of dental emergencies that call for immediate attention. Tooth discomfort that's sharp, relentless, or accompanied by swelling could indicate an infection or an abscess, which requires timely care from a dental practitioner.
In addition, a knocked-out tooth, whether as a result of a fall or a crash, is one more crucial scenario where fast activity is crucial for potential re-implantation.
Other signs of oral emergencies in youngsters consist of bleeding that doesn't quit after using stress, a split or fractured tooth, or a loose tooth due to trauma. Any type of injury to the mouth that results in too much blood loss, swelling, or severe discomfort shouldn't be neglected and requires immediate evaluation by an oral professional.
Being able to identify these indications early on and looking for timely treatment can help prevent better problems and make sure the very best feasible end result for your youngster's oral health.
Immediate Emergency Treatment Steps
In cases of oral emergencies in children, quickly applying emergency treatment procedures can assist minimize discomfort and minimize possible problems.
If your kid experiences a knocked-out tooth, gently rinse it with water, bewaring not to touch the root, and try to reinsert it into the outlet. If this isn't possible, save the tooth in a glass of milk or saliva and seek instant oral care.

Preventing Future Dental Emergencies
To avoid future oral emergency situations in children, developing constant oral health behaviors is vital. See to it your child brushes their teeth two times a day with fluoride toothpaste and flosses daily.
Regular oral exams are vital for early discovery of any kind of issues and professional cleanings. Urge your child to put on a mouthguard throughout sports activities to shield their teeth from injury.
Limitation sugary snacks and drinks in their diet plan to reduce the threat of cavities and dental cavity. Show them exactly how to effectively make use of oral devices like toothbrushes and floss to advertise good oral health.
Advise them on the significance of avoiding biting down on difficult objects and opening up plans with their teeth to prevent oral injury. By instilling these practices early on, you can aid your kid preserve a healthy smile and minimize the chance of future oral emergencies.
